First of all, let us give you some base ideas exactly what modular kitchens are?
A modular kitchen is constructed with pre-made cabinet parts – wall units. Floor units, tall storage units, and countertops as well. They usually consist of internal accessories and electro gadgets such as hob, dishwasher, electric chimney, built-in oven, grill, refrigerator and other gadgets.
They sound really lucrative and expensive then why should one opt for the modular kitchen?
Nowadays, well-planned and chic looking modular kitchens have become a necessity for efficient space utilization. A modular kitchen has quite a number of advantages over a civil kitchen. Following are few pros:
- It offers a lot of storage space even in the smallest of kitchens.
- Repairs can be done easily.
- Individual components can be replaced without affecting other components of the kitchen.
- Installation does not take up much time or effort.
- Cleaning and maintenance require less effort.
